Lead Compensation Analyst

Ladders · United States · 4 wk ago
RemoteRemoteHuman Resources$120k–$192k/yrFull-time

Responsibilities

  • Own statutory pay reporting obligations in the US and internationally
  • Serve as an expert on the EU Pay Transparency Directive and ensure compliance
  • Lead annual and ad-hoc salary survey submissions, ensuring data integrity
  • Act as primary SME for compensation systems, maintaining integrity and troubleshooting
  • Collaborate with Legal, HR, and Finance to meet pay reporting requirements
  • Conduct analysis of compensation data to identify trends and equity concerns
  • Support design and maintenance of compensation policies related to pay reporting

Qualifications

  • 5-7 years of experience in compensation analysis or related role
  • Deep knowledge of US and international pay reporting regulations, especially the EU Pay Transparency Directive
  • Hands-on experience with compensation systems like Pave, Compa, Comptryx, Radford, and Workday
  • Advanced analytical skills with large datasets, including proficiency in Excel or Google Sheets
  • Strong project management skills to handle multiple deadlines effectively
  • Bachelor's degree in HR, business, finance, or similar; relevant experience accepted in lieu of degree
  • CCP designation preferred but not mandatory
